Perhaps we would want to look at some sort of <br />land development fee that applies uniformly to all new <br />developers, even west of 1-95, with that money being put into a <br />fund for buying county access to the river and ocean. <br />ON MOTION by Commissioner Scurlock, SECONDED by <br />Commissioner Eggert, the Board unanimously directed <br />staff to explore the requirement for developers paying <br />funds in lieu of providing beach or river access and <br />come back to the Board with a recommendation for the <br />overall update of this element of the Zoning Code. <br />REPORT ON COORDINATION OF LIBRARY AND COURTHOUSE PROJECTS <br />Administrator Chandler reported that he had a couple of <br />meetings on this matter this past week, but still needed to meet <br />with several other people and groups. Yesterday, staff filed <br />with the City of Vero Beach for the abandonment of 22nd Street <br />between 16th and 17th Avenues. In the meeting with the City, <br />Walter Young indicated to us that if we could agree on a basic <br />thoroughfare plan for the entire area, we would not need a <br />separate traffic study for our 6 -block area. Public Works <br />Director Jim Davis will be bringing that back to the Board. <br />However, for planning purposes, he felt direction is needed from <br />the Board on several matters, and suggested that we have a <br />general workshop at a regular meeting in February where staff <br />would lay out all alternatives and identify those areas where we <br />feel there are questions.
